It would be very unlike VW to have different engines for auto vs manual transmissions.

I read a whole thread about swapping a manual transmission into an automatic 2008 MK5 2.5L car. Nowhere did it mention any changed needed to the engine itself.

To MLue's point I would be more concerned with the power steering setup (hydraulic vs electronic). Some later engines used hydraulic power steering. Even at that because you will strip it down even that probably won't mater as you have all the externall parts already from your current engine.
